<br />'-- <br /> <br />13. Vehicle Parking. No unlicensed or inoperative vehicles of any <br />kind including boats, trucks, campers, trailers, recreational <br />vehicles, motorcycles, or similar vehicles shall be parked on <br />any road, street, private driveway, or lot. Operating and <br />licensed vehicles (of the kind and nature described above) may <br />be parked on a lot provided it is screened in such a way that <br />it is not visible to the occupants of the adjacent lots. No <br />vehicle of any kind shall be parked on the street except for <br />a reasonable length of time. The Architectural Control <br />Committee shall approve screening and determine what is a <br />reasonable length of time. <br /> <br />14. Business Use. No mercantile or business establishment of any <br />kind or character shall be erected, altered, permitted or <br />maintained on any lot. <br /> <br />15. Storage Tanks. <br />allowed. <br /> <br />No bulk storage tanks of any kind will be <br /> <br />16. utility/Storage Buildings. Utility building, mini-barn or <br />accessory building, exteriors must be compatable with the main <br />structure. <br /> <br />17. Signal Receiver. No antenna, signal receiver, satellite dish <br />or similar device may be placed closer to the front lot line <br />than ten (10) feet back from the front of the dwelling <br />structure. <br /> <br />'- <br /> <br />17. Architectural Control Committee. An architectural control <br />committee shall review and approve all plans for the <br />construction of residential dwelling houses and accessory <br />buildings to promote harmony of design and compatibility with <br />existing structures. The committee also shall approve any <br />technical variation or exception from any construction <br />requirements. No reasonable design may be denied. The <br />committee shall initially consist of two (2) developer's <br />representatives. The developer shall make all appointments <br />until all lots are sold in all present and subsequent sections <br />of Country View Estates Subdivision. Thereafter, the <br />committee shall consist of five (5) resident owners. <br /> <br />18. Architectural Design. No building, wall, fence, or other <br />structure shall be constructed, erected, placed or altered in <br />this subdivision until the location plan, building plans, and <br />specifications have been first submitted to, and approved by, <br />the Architectural Control Committee as to conformity with the <br />exterior design, quality, and aesthetic appearance of <br />structures already existing, as to conformity with grading <br />plans, first floor elevations, destruction of trees and other <br />vegetation, and any other such matter as may affect the <br />environment or ecology of the subdivision. The Architectural <br />control Committee's approval or disapproval as required in <br />these covenants shall be in writing.
